On 1/5/19 10:28 PM, Alice Wonder wrote: > Requiring TLS is pointless if the MX record is not secure. I'm inclined to disagree. - I see value in requiring TLS via STARTTLS even if the MX record wasn't secured. - I say inclined because I can't articulate the combinations of unmodified / modified MX record in conjunction with all the other possibilities that connections can be tampered with. Be it hijacking / route poisoning / simply filtering out STARTTLS but not altering anything else. > That's why MTA-STS needs the https component, to secure the MX record > when DNSSEC is not used to do so. > > When DNSSEC is used, DANE then is better at securing the connection so > MTA-STS is only needed when the server and/or client do not support DANE > for SMTP. I disagree. I believe the value of MTA-STS (and HSTS) is the ability to signal that SMTP (HTTP) should -ONLY- be conducted over a secure connection via STARTTLS (TLS). Meaning that SMTP (HTTP) should fail if there isn't a secure connection. The signaling of this fact is what makes MTA-STS so valuable to me. To me, the other aspects of DNSSEC / HTTPS are simply infrastructure necessary to enable delivery of the STS signal. -- Grant. . . . unix || die
